[QUOTE="BLACKJKU, post: 441991, member: 18221"] The existing oil sensor is in a hard to reach place on the right front. I found a 1/4 NPT plug if I remember right on the left side between the timing cover and motor mount. If you look there you will see it, that's where they put the oil sensor on the Vans that's how I found out it was there. [/QUOTE]
